Hallucinations in nonpsychotic children and adolescents.

机构信息

University of Missouri Medical School, Columbia, Missouri.

出版信息

J Youth Adolesc. 1975 Jun;4(2):171-82. doi: 10.1007/BF01537440.

Abstract

The case histories of ten nonpsychotic patients (nine female and one male) who had experienced hallucinations are summarized. Significant anxiety and depression were found in the majority of the patients, five of whom expressed suicidal ideas. Stress factors were primarily family and school. Eight children had combined auditory and visual hallucinations, which involved dead relatives in five cases. The aims or purposes of the hallucinations were multiple, but escape mechanisms were most common. A profile of the nonpsychotic patient most likely to experience hallucinations would be a socially immature teenage girl who is experiencing depression and anxiety due to stress within the family.
